OK guys I know this is a bit off the subject but there is a lot of people on this site with old magazines and knowledge so here goes...I am restoring a 66 GTO Funny Car from 1966. It was called The Gray Ghost and was from Chicago. The owner was Larry Swiatek and he was heavily into Pontiacs back then.Raced several Super Duty cars etc ..all called Gray Ghost. I traced him to New Hampshire where he owned a couple McDonalds franchises but he doesnt anymore and the last I heard he went possibly to Florida.Anyway to make this short as possible ..If anyone happens to see a picture or 2 of this car in any old mags please let me know. It was painted by Dick Scully,headers by Iggy,chassis by R&B Engineering and body by Ron Pellegrini...these were all local folks whom I've talked to including Swiateks partner Mike Garfinkel but haven't been able to muster any photo history yet...any help will be appreciated...I am going to try other boards as well but thought I would start at home base.I can have someone post a pic if anyone is interested but it's real ugly right now .

Bob, There's a two page article in a magazine called "Popular Customs - The Wild, Wild, World of Funny Cars", Nov/Dec '66 issue on "The Gray Ghost". It's mostly pictures. I'd be glad to send you copies. Greg

I checked some of my old photos from the Oswego Drag Strip. I have a photo of a 1968 or 69 GTO funny car called the Gray Ghost with Swiatek and Scully's name on it. The car had a yellow and red custom paint job, and the photo was probably from 1971. I'm guessing that this was built after the '66 GTO was retired.

WOW great so far...Greg I will send you a note offline for the Popular Customs .....Steven J.....the 68 was sponsored by Dick Scully and was the next car after the 66,which had evolved to a 1 piece tilt body...I think they went Hemi then...the 66 was Pontiac powered for a while and may have gone Chevy....68 was wild paint and Scully wants to find that one...Bowtie...I have checked Mysterion which is one of the coolest sites around for early Funnies and asked Jim Sorensen for info but nothing yet.I have talked to Mr.Beswick previously about my Super Duty Catalina.He remembered that car very well as he was good friends at the time with the owner of SD car,Mr. Jake Howard.Unfortunately he couldn't offer much more on that car .I will ask him about Funny since he had one of the 3 (Ithink) bodies built by Fiberglass LTD. Its so ugly right now I'm afraid to get that close to it.But no there are no event stickers on it. Probably a lot of Midwest UDRA stuff is where it hung out more than likely. It was sold and later called The Assassin.....Hemi powered.Mick,this thing is a bit crude to actually race unless it was totally updated and I don't want to do that. No Tech inspector would even let it in the gate !
